Siemer Lake
About Siemer Lake
Siemer Lake is a charming destination for those seeking a quiet fishing spot in Waupaca County, Wisconsin. This modest lake spans about 34 acres, offering a cozy outdoor experience surrounded by the small towns of Iola, Scandinavia, and Ogdensburg. Its shallow waters, with a maximum depth around 10 feet, make it accessible and inviting for anglers and nature lovers alike. The lake's location near Hartman Creek State Park adds to the natural appeal, providing a scenic backdrop that enhances the peaceful atmosphere. Fish species
Largemouth Bass, Panfish
